The issue is that 'page' is now expected to be under 'named' in
$this->request->params.

My route:

Router::connect(
        '/admin/contributors/:page',
        array(
                'admin' => 1,
                'controller' => 'contributors',
                'action' => 'index'
        ),
        array(
                'page' => '[0-9]+'
        )
);

I like my routes the way they are so I made a quick fix in
AppController::beforeFilter()

if (isset($this->request->params['page']))
{
        $this->request->params['named']['page'] = 
$this->request->params['page'];
}
